The HT-20 is loud enough for band practice with its combo speaker alone and it fills nicely and cuts better then anything i have owned. I havent actually miced it up but thats the plan, but i am looking into making a 2x12 cabinet and a headshell for the HT-20, i'll post progress of course :)

The HT-40 wasn't that much louder (different speaker though) but i dont even have mine all the way up. But i dare say the headroom is much higher on the 40 though, the 20 just had that mid punch when it absolutely dimed which i like.

Both are great amps but if you are worried about the 20 not being loud enough the 40 is not much more expensive or larger.
